Roof Reshingling in Providence, RI

Roof reshingling services involve replacing the existing roofing material with new shingles to restore the integrity and appearance of a property’s roof. This service typically covers projects where the current roof has aged, sustained damage, or is showing signs of wear such as curling, missing shingles, or leaks. Homeowners often request reshingling to improve curb appeal, enhance weather resistance, or prepare for resale.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the condition of their current roof, the type of shingles they prefer, and any specific requirements for their home’s style or local building codes.

Understanding the scope of a reshingling project is important for homeowners and property owners. This service can involve replacing only the top layer of shingles or a full tear-off and replacement of the entire roofing system. It is common for property owners to want details about the durability of different shingle options, the expected lifespan of the new roof, and how the project might impact their daily routine during installation. Clarifying these aspects can help ensure the project aligns with long-term maintenance goals and aesthetic preferences.

FAQ

Roof Reshingling Questions

What types of roofs can be reshingled? Reshingling can be performed on various roof types, including asphalt shingles, wood shakes, and composite materials, depending on the existing roof structure.

Why consider roof reshingling? Reshingling helps restore the roof’s appearance, improve weather resistance, and extend its lifespan without the need for full replacement.

What signs indicate the need for reshingling? Visible damage such as missing shingles, curling edges, granule loss, or leaks can signal that reshingling may be necessary.
